When I was a 12yr old little girl, I always wanted to be a model.
So my parents took me to King of Prussia mall to meet with an agent at Horizon Model Company. I remember the drive down, the long walk through the hidden hallways within the mall and the desk where I sat across from the most important person in the world
to me in that moment. I also remember them telling me to come back when I was
taller because of my scoliosis and didn’t have braces anymore.
Dream squashed.
Yet, I always had this vision in the back of my mind of me standing on a stage somewhere looking out over hundreds of people.
I had continually pushed it into the back of my mind because I didn’t know what it meant.
As I grew up, I was told I “had a way with certain kids.” So I became a teacher.
